Namibian Newspapers reported their win against Sri Lanka

October 17, 2022October 17, 2022 admin

Namibia create a history and Registered 55 runs win over Sri Lanka. It was one of the major upsets in this tournament. Most of Namibian newspapers reported this win in their front page.
